A motorcycle and an SUV collided on Highway 53 last night.
BRANT - A 28-year-old from Woodstock has died after a two-vehicle crash in Brant County.
Police say a motorcycle and an SUV collided on Highway 53, west of Burford, shortly before 10:00 p.m. yesterday. The Woodstonian was driving the motorcycle at the time.
The OPP closed portions of Highway 53 and Middle Townline Road for the investigation, but the areas have since reopened.
The investigation remains ongoing at this time. The OPP would like to speak with anyone who may have witnessed the crash or have surveillance or dash cam footage of the area around the time it happened.
Anyone with information can call the Brant OPP at 1-888-310-1122. You can also submit an anonymous tip to Crime Stoppers by calling 1-800-222-8477.
